rejected by Elegant_Rope4930 in Baruch

[–]KingRasu 6 points7 points  (0 children)

Admissions offices also consider the likelihood that an admitted student will actually accept their offer. In some cases, they may determine that a student is unlikely to enroll if admitted.

From the schools perspective, offering admission to a student who declines can represent a missed opportunity. Not only does the school lose that student, but it may also have passed over another applicant who might have accepted the offer. Because of this, enrollment management model these scenarios to maintain a high yield rate (the percentage of admitted students who choose to enroll) often aiming for rates above 90%. While this doesn’t help, it may explain what could have happened.
